Patna: Expelled BJP leader, Jaswant Singh said Bihar would provide the paltform to launch a nation-wide agitation for all round development of the country and change its political system.

Referring to the movements of Mahatma Gandhi and Jaiparakash Narain, Singh told a function, organised to release an Urdu version of his ontroversial book 'Jinnah-India, Partition, Independence' here, "I am sure the people of Bihar will once again lead the nation to ensure a historical change in the Indian polity."


Singh thanked the national president of All India United Muslim Morcha and Rajya Sabha MP Dr M Ejaz Ali for releasing the Urdu translation of his book.


Thanking Singh for writing the book, former MP and eminent journalist, M J Akbar said "Indian Muslims are the most secular and they do not require certificate from any politcal party or leaders to prove that."

Senior columinst Prabhash Jsohi said Jaswant Singh had not written the book to earn money but to enlighten the Muslims of the country to participate in politics and demand their dues.

Former union minister Arif Mohammad Khan said the leaders of both communities should remain prepared to fight communalism to make the nation strong.
